A beautifully presented modern detached house situated in this popular village development. 4 bedrooms, open plan living accommodation and a large south facing landscaped garden. EPC Rating B.

Situation - The property is situated in the highly sought-after village of North Curry and is within walking distance of the village centre with its excellent range of local amenities including a village store / Post Office, Inn, Primary school, coffee shop, hairdressers, Doctors surgery, Church and playing fields with a cricket pitch and pavilion. The village of North Curry has a number of footpaths and bridleways, perfect for those with walking and riding interests.

The property is approximately 6 miles from the County town of Taunton with a wide range of shopping, leisure and scholastic facilities. There is access to the M5 motorway via Junctions 25 and also easy access to the A303. The property is located in a desirable village with easy access to all main routes of communication.

Description - 33 Loscombe Meadow is an attractive double fronted modern detached house constructed of mellow brick elevations under a pitch slate roof. The house was built by the well-respected Strongvox Developers in 2017 and includes accommodation arranged over two floors. The property enjoys a wonderful outlook at the front, over a communal green and fields to the rear.

Accommodation - From the covered porch, the front door opens through to the entrance hallway with stairs leading to the first floor, an under stairs storage cupboard and cloakroom. The open plan living accommodation creates a wonderful feeling of space and includes wooden effect flooring, which continues predominantly throughout the ground floor. The sitting room has a wood burner and overlooks the green to the front, whilst the dining area has twin double doors to the garden. The kitchen is fitted with a range of shaker style wall and base units with Quartz worksurfaces, a one and a half bowl sink unit, built-in oven, hob, extractor and integrated dishwasher. There is a door opening to the utility, where there is a door to the parking area and plumbing and space for laundry appliances. There is also a study, which again overlooks the front.

To the first floor, the galleried landing leads to the four bedrooms and family bathroom. The principal bedroom benefits from an en-suite shower room and built in mirrored wardrobes along one side. Bedrooms two and three are both light and spacious double rooms with built-in mirrored wardrobes. Bedroom four enjoys a wonderful outlook over the front communal green. There is a family bathroom with a fitted matching suite.

Outside - To the front is an area of garden with a pathway leading to the front door and generous off-road parking for at least four vehicles, which leads to the detached double garage with twin up and over doors. A gateway leads from the parking area to the rear garden, where there is a deep paved patio area providing space to entertain family and friends. The garden is predominately laid to lawn with deep planted herbaceous borders. There are two raised vegetable beds and a number of planted trees and shrubs including a number of fruit trees. The gardens are delightful, enjoying a wonderful outlook to the fields and countryside beyond, are South facing and fully enclosed.

Taunton is the county town of Somerset, with over 1,000 years of religious and military history, its name comes from "Town on the River Tone", which is the river that flows through the town. Taunton has a number of fine historic buildings, including Taunton Castle, which now incorporates the Somerset County Museum and the Castle Hotel, Gray's Almhouses, St James Church, Priory Barn (Somerset County Cricket Museum), Bath Place and the Tudor Tavern (now Café Nero). As one of the Government's "Strategically important towns or cities", Taunton has received funding for a number of large-scale regeneration projects, which have further established the town as a major business destination in the South West. Taunton has excellent shopping and leisure facilities, with a number of indoor shopping complexes, high street multiples and quality independent shops, as well as restaurants and cafes. As a sporting centre, Taunton has much to offer, with horse racing at Taunton Racecourse, just two miles from the town centre, and cricket at the County Ground, which is home to Somerset County Cricket Club. In addition, there are excellent tennis and general sports facilities available at Tone Leisure Centre.
